Price to rent ratio
Price to rent ratio (p/r) is computed by dividing the median property price by the annual median gross rent. A site with high lease rates will have a lower p/r. You need a low p/r and higher rents that could pay off your property more quickly. Look out for a too low p/r, which can make it more costly to rent a property than to purchase one. You could give up tenants to the home buying market that will increase the number of your unused investment properties. However, lower p/r indicators are ordinarily more acceptable than high ratios.

Long Term Rental (BRRRR)
The acronym BRRRR is an illustration of a long-term lease strategy — Buy, Rehab, Rent, Refinance, Repeat. This is a strategy to increase your investment assets rather than acquire one rental property. A crucial part of this formula is to be able to obtain a “cash-out” refinance.
When you are done with fixing the property, its market value must be more than your complete acquisition and renovation spendings. The asset is refinanced using the ARV and the difference, or equity, comes to you in cash. You acquire your next house with the cash-out money and begin anew. This plan enables you to consistently expand your assets and your investment revenue.

Short-Term Rental Cash-on-Cash Return
Cash-on-cash return is a method to evaluate the value of an investment. Take your expected Net Operating Income (NOI) and divide it by your investment cash budget. The answer you get is a percentage. High cash-on-cash return shows that you will recoup your money faster and the purchase will have a higher return. If you get financing for a portion of the investment and spend less of your own funds, you will get a higher cash-on-cash return.
Average Short-Term Rental Capitalization (Cap) Rates
Average short-term rental capitalization (cap) levels are widely employed by real property investors to assess the worth of rentals. In general, the less a property will cost (or is worth), the higher the cap rate will be. If investment properties in a market have low cap rates, they typically will cost more money. The cap rate is calculated by dividing the Net Operating Income (NOI) by the price or market worth. The percentage you get is the property’s cap rate.

Wholesaling
In real estate wholesaling, you search for a home that investors may think is a profitable deal and sign a contract to buy the property. However you don’t close on it: once you have the property under contract, you get a real estate investor to take your place for a price. The contracted property is sold to the investor, not the real estate wholesaler. You’re selling the rights to the purchase contract, not the house itself.

Mortgage Note Investing
Investing in mortgage notes (loans) is successful when the mortgage note can be bought for less than the face value. This way, the purchaser becomes the mortgage lender to the original lender’s borrower.
Loans that are being repaid as agreed are referred to as performing notes. Performing notes earn repeating cash flow for you. Investors also obtain non-performing loans that the investors either rework to help the borrower or foreclose on to get the property less than actual value.

Foreclosure Laws
It’s important for mortgage note investors to know the foreclosure laws in their state. Many states use mortgage documents and some utilize Deeds of Trust. A mortgage dictates that the lender goes to court for approval to foreclose. A Deed of Trust authorizes the lender to file a notice and continue to foreclosure.

Property Taxes
Payments for property taxes are most often paid to the mortgage lender simultaneously with the loan payment. The mortgage lender pays the payments to the Government to make sure the taxes are submitted on time. The mortgage lender will have to make up the difference if the payments stop or the lender risks tax liens on the property. Tax liens go ahead of all other liens.
If property taxes keep growing, the homebuyer’s house payments also keep increasing. Overdue customers may not be able to keep paying increasing loan payments and could interrupt making payments altogether.

Syndications
In real estate, a syndication is a collection of investors who combine their capital and abilities to acquire real estate assets for investment. One partner structures the deal and invites the others to participate.
The member who pulls everything together is the Sponsor, also called the Syndicator. The Syndicator oversees all real estate activities such as purchasing or creating properties and overseeing their operation. The Sponsor handles all business issues including the disbursement of income.
Syndication partners are passive investors. The partnership agrees to pay them a preferred return once the investments are turning a profit. These members have no obligations concerned with supervising the partnership or managing the use of the assets.

Ownership Interest
Every stakeholder owns a piece of the company. If there are sweat equity members, expect those who place funds to be compensated with a more significant percentage of interest.
As a capital investor, you should also expect to receive a preferred return on your capital before income is split. The percentage of the amount invested (preferred return) is disbursed to the investors from the cash flow, if any. After the preferred return is distributed, the rest of the net revenues are disbursed to all the members.
If the asset is eventually liquidated, the members receive an agreed percentage of any sale proceeds. Adding this to the regular revenues from an investment property markedly enhances a partner’s results. The company’s operating agreement determines the ownership structure and the way members are treated financially.
REITs
A REIT, or Real Estate Investment Trust, means a business that makes investments in income-producing real estate. REITs are invented to allow average investors to invest in real estate. The typical investor can afford to invest in a REIT.
Participants in these trusts are entirely passive investors. Investment risk is spread throughout a portfolio of real estate. Shares can be liquidated when it is convenient for the investor. Participants in a REIT are not able to recommend or submit real estate properties for investment. The properties that the REIT selects to purchase are the ones your capital is used to purchase.
Real Estate Investment Funds
A Real Estate Investment Fund is a mutual fund that possesses stocks of real estate companies. The investment assets aren’t possessed by the fund — they are owned by the companies the fund invests in. These funds make it possible for more people to invest in real estate. Where REITs are meant to disburse dividends to its shareholders, funds don’t. Like other stocks, investment funds’ values rise and decrease with their share market value.
You may choose a fund that concentrates on specific segments of the real estate business but not particular markets for each real estate property investment. You have to rely on the fund’s managers to determine which locations and real estate properties are picked for investment.
